先来聊聊学习数据结构与算法 数据结构与算法,听起来就难得不要不要的 数据结构与算法,到底该怎么学????? 通用性建议---如何学习编程知识? 1、你需要的不是一个参考 2、不要钻牛角尖 3、...
先来聊聊学习数据结构与算法 数据结构与算法,听起来就难得不要不要的 数据结构与算法,到底该怎么学????? 通用性建议---如何学习编程知识? 1、你需要的不是一个参考 2、不要钻牛角尖 3、...
最近准备先着手写一个【数据结构与算法】的专栏!!! 完事开头难,过程难上加难。今天就把开头难这个事情解决掉!!! 我是渣渣,渣渣是我,因渣而骄傲! 作为一个本科非CS出生的我,不知不觉在敲代码的路上渐行渐...
我叫《数据结构与算法》,是计算机世界的四大基石之一。 想来我应该是惹人怜爱的吧(认真脸),因为我仿佛听到了无数个初入计算机世界的同学的呐喊声(????)。 我作为一门简单学科,看到有很多的在半途弃我而去,我...
数据结构 数据库 Android项目基础设施 QRCode Jenkins奇技淫巧系列 JVM 1. JVM执行分析 2. JVM内存模型和垃圾收集 3. 垃圾收集策略 4. G1收集器 5. Java引用类型 网络传输 正则表达式 Git 计算机组成原理(正在填补中...
LeetCode刷题思路笔记初级入门思路笔记 初级入门思路笔记 对于暴力解法 需要双层for循环 注意 条件设置(不需要两次都全部遍历) 对于找某数的题 ,找不到后 需要抛出异常,而不是返回空*。 ...
你是否曾跟我一样,因为看不懂数据结构和算法,而一度怀疑是自己太笨?实际上,很多人在第一次接触这门课时,都会有这种感觉,觉得数据结构和算法很抽象,晦涩难懂,宛如天书。正是这个原因,让很多初学者对这门课...
一 个人信息微信公众号:【推荐】右侧公众号为 浪子神剑 公众号,对应 GitHub 存放:,以面试题来驱动学习,坚持每天学习与思考,每天进步一点!个人微信:微信群:(已满 100 人,需要先加 jsliang 微信,通知 ...
很久没有更新文章了,后面准备连载一个关于《数据结构与算法》的系列教程,喜欢的同学记得分享转发。 1、第一印象 (1)复杂、深奥、难学? 一提到数据结构与算法,大家对它的第一印象就是:复杂、深奥、难学。其实...
算法是用于解决特定问题的一系列的执行步骤。使用不同算法,解决同一个问题,效率可能相差非常大。为了对算法的好坏进行评价,我们引入 “算法复杂度” 的概念。 1、引例:斐波那契数列(Fibonacci sequence) 已知...
点击上方“五分钟学算法”,选择“星标”公众号重磅干货,第一时间送达来源:知乎编辑:雅新、舒婷【新智元导读】近日,一位网友在知乎上发起提问:计算机学生在大学四年应是以数据结构和算法为重还是...
吴师兄导读:有哪些常见的数据结构?基本操作是什么?常见的排序算法是如何实现的?各有什么优缺点?本文简要分享算法基础、常见的数据结构以及排序算法,给同学们带来一堂数据结构和算法的基础课。一...
- 《数据结构与算法》专栏完整版在公众号【书伟认视界】中查看,转载需联系微信【econe0219】 散列表 散列表(Hash Table),也可直译为哈希表。散列表是基于数组扩展得到的一种新的数据结构,因此有延续了数组最...
说明:这是武汉理工大学计算机学院数据结构与算法综合实验课程的第一次项目:二叉树与赫夫曼图片压缩实践代码。 源码下载地址:点击此处下载本次实验项目(运行环境:VS2017) 关注微信公众号【知行校园汇】可免费...
系统堆栈的故事+数据结构中的堆和栈
第一章 为了编写一个“好程序”,必须分析待处理的对象的特征,以及各处理对象之间存在的关系。 计算机解决一个具体问题时,需要经过以下几个步骤...开发一些文档类管理系统……在这类文档管理的数学模型中,计算机处理
本文主要从以下几个方面展开(文章目录) 0、写在前面的话 1、项目演示与源码下载 2、项目指导参考视频 3、实验教材 4、实验任务、目的与要求 5、实现说明 6、核心代码 7、运行结果截图
[算法与数据结构] 一文详解线性查找法~前言一、算法基础知识1、什么是算法2、算法的五大特性二、线性查找法1、举例阐述2、实现线性查找法3、使用泛型4、升级改造5、使用自定义类6、循环不变量三、算法复杂度1、简单...
1. 什么是递归 举一个例子:大学军训的时候,一个队伍,开头的人A想知道这个队伍一共有多少人,但是每个人只能通过旁边的交流,那如何统计呢? 我们可以先找出最后一个人,A可以问旁边的人B是否为最后一个人,B又...
李开复曾经把基础课程比拟为“内功”,把新的语言、技术、标准比拟为“外功”。整天赶时髦的人最后只懂得招式,没有功力,是不可能成为高手的。真正学懂计算机的人(不只是“编程匠”...
对于数据结构与算法的学习,我相信不管是新手还是老手,都会对“逻辑结构、存储结构”产生很多的疑问。你可能觉得不就是两个简单的概念嘛,早就了然于胸了。 Wait! 先不要急着下定论,我们还是先来看一道题目。...
文章目录一、广度优先遍历定义二、基本实现思想三、代码实现(以图的存储结构邻接表为例)四、示例测试 一、广度优先遍历定义 图的广度优先遍历BFS算法是一个分层搜索的过程,和树的层序遍历算法...